您的位置:首页 > 其它

set集合的三种遍历方式

2018-02-05 12:00 267 查看
1.利用迭代器进行 ,迭代遍历:
Set<Object> sets = new HashSet<Object>();
Iterator<Object> it = set.iterator();
while (it.hasNext()) {
  String str = (String)it.next();
  System.out.println(str);
}

2.for循环遍历
for (String str : sets) {
      System.out.println(str);
}

3.Set<Object> set = new HashSet<Object>();

foreach循环遍历
for (Object obj: sets) {
      if(obj instanceof Integer){
                int aa= (Integer)obj;
             }else if(obj instanceof String){
               String aa = (String)obj
             }
              ……..

}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  set遍历